First draft - Masthead

Once I started my first draft, I decided that the first part I would draft/design should be my masthead. Below is a picture of my first draft of my masthead.


For this first draft, I decided to use the Geometr885 BT font because of the large bold text that can be filled with colour to make it stand out against the white box. The masthead has been boxed out with a white box on my draft so that it stands out against the background which is a mixture of dark and light greys. I chose to use these colours for the masthead because they I thought they worked well with the rest of the colours on the page. The I.R.M has been written in full underneath the acronym so that people can identify what the acronym means, and it could also be used as a slogan. This text has not been filled in in grey yet but it will be as the draft progresses.
